This new DNA test could help people beat depression fasterFor people who suffer from depression, treatment is often a game of chance. Thirty to forty percent of people don’t respond well to the first anti-depressant they’re prescribed. So they try another. And then possibly another. It can take months or even years to nail down a medication that relieves symptoms without leaving behind a haze of unpleasant side effects.
